Purpose: The Dr. Scholl Foundation is dedicated to providing
financial assistance to organizations committed to improving our world.
Applications for small grants are considered in education, social service, healthcare, civic and cultural and environmental areas.
However, these categories are not intended to limit the interest of the
foundation from considering other worthwhile projects. In general, the
foundation guidelines are broad to give the board flexibility in providing
grants. The foundation believes solutions to the problems of today’s world still
lie in the values of innovation, practicality, hard work and
compassion.
Funding Amount/ Project
Period: from $5,000 to $25,000 for 1
year
